Abstract
14,680. Parsons, C. A., and Law, A. H. June 17. Coils and conductors, securing. Rotor end windings, more particularly of turbo-generators, are secured by bolts or studs screwed into, or having heads let into slots in the shaft or a hub thereon. Bolts d, Fig. 2, preferably of non- magnetic material, are fixed in slots k by caulking m, and retain the end windings c by means of washers g. The bolt heads may be as shown or may be detachable. In modifications the bolts are screwed in, or are square and are provided with rectangular heads which are admitted into slots o, Fig. 6, by enlarged openings p. Circular bolts may be provided with the form of head shown in Fig. 7. Cotters may be used instead of nuts, and the heads h and slots k may be corrugated.
